Connect Microsoft Excel and Moodle to power AI-driven automation
- No-code AI automation
- Full audit trails and controls
- SOC 2 and GDPR compliant
- Easy visual workflow builder
- 8,000+ apps, 450+ AI tools
- Free tier available
How Zapier works
Zapier makes it easy to integrate Microsoft Excel with Moodle - no code necessary. See how you can get setup in minutes.
Choose a trigger
A trigger is the event that starts your Zap—like a "New Row" from Microsoft Excel.
Add your action
An action happens after the trigger—such as "API Request (Beta)" in Moodle.
You’re connected!
Zapier seamlessly connects Microsoft Excel and Moodle, automating your workflow.
Supported triggers and actions
Zapier helps you create workflows that connect your apps to automate repetitive tasks. A trigger is an event that starts a workflow, and an action is an event a Zap performs.
-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- WorksheetRequired
Try ItTriggerPolling-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
Try ItTriggerPolling-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- WorksheetRequired
ActionWrite-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- WorksheetRequired
- TableRequired
ActionWrite
-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- WorksheetRequired
- TableRequired
Try ItTriggerPolling-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- WorksheetRequired
- Trigger Column
Try ItTriggerPolling-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- WorksheetRequired
ActionWrite- Plan Restrictions
- Storage_source
- Folder
- WorkbookRequired
- Worksheet IDRequired
- RangeRequired
- Apply To
ActionWrite
Zapier is the automation platform of choice for 87% of Forbes Cloud 100 companies in 2023




93%
Customers who say using Zapier has made them better at their job
25m
Customers have created over 25 million Zaps on the platform
6 mins
The average user takes less than 6 minutes to set up a Zap
Learn how to automate Microsoft Excel on the Zapier blog
Frequently Asked Questions about Microsoft Excel + Moodle integrations
New to automation with Zapier? You're not alone. Here are some answers to common questions about how Zapier works with Microsoft Excel and Moodle
How can I automatically add new Moodle users to an Excel spreadsheet?
To automatically add new Moodle users to an Excel spreadsheet, you can set up a trigger in our platform. The trigger would be a 'New User' event in Moodle. Once this event is detected, the action should be configured to 'Create Row' in Excel, which will populate the spreadsheet with the new user's details such as name, email address, and enrollment date.
Is it possible to track Moodle course completions within an Excel sheet?
Yes, you can track Moodle course completions in an Excel sheet by setting up a trigger-action automation. The trigger should be set as 'Course Completed' in Moodle, and the action as 'Update Data Row' or 'Create Data Row' in Excel. This setup allows you to log each completion along with relevant details like student name, course name, and date of completion.
Can I use Zapier to update grades from an Excel file into Moodle?
While our platform supports various integrations between different applications, updating grades from an Excel file into Moodle is typically a manual process within these systems due to the sensitive nature of assessment data. However, you can export data from Moodle for analysis elsewhere or use automated processes for data collection.
How do I synchronize attendance records between Moodle and Excel?
To synchronize attendance records between Moodle and Excel, we recommend setting up a trigger for 'Attendance Updated' events in Moodle. Each updated record can then initiate an action to either 'Create Row' or 'Update Row' in your designated Excel file, ensuring that both systems reflect the same attendance information.
What types of data from Moodle can be exported into Excel using integrations?
Through our integration setups, you can export various types of data from Moodle into Excel including user information, course enrollments and completions, quiz results, forum posts counts or summaries etc. Triggers such as 'New Enrollment', 'Quiz Completed', or other specific actions allow this information to flow seamlessly into corresponding rows and columns in your spreadsheets.
How often does Zapier check for new data between Microsoft Excel and Moodle?
Our platform typically checks for new data every 5-15 minutes depending on your plan type. For real-time updates such as new enrollments or grades inputted into either platform triggering corresponding actions like row creation/updating would follow this polling frequency unless specified otherwise.
Are there any limitations when integrating Microsoft Excel with Moodle through Zapier's platform?
Some limitations may include restricted access based on permission settings within either application or potential delays due to API call limits on free plans. Additionally, certain complex manipulations might require multi-step Zaps which could incur additional latency or require plan upgrades for more frequent checks.




